Takayuki Ito is a pioneering researcher at the intersection of speech science and multisensory integration, best known for his groundbreaking work on how somatosensory feedback from facial skin shapes speech perception and motor learning. His landmark 2009 study, cited 187 times, was the first to demonstrate that somatosensory signals from facial skin deformation actively influence how we perceive speech, challenging the traditional view that speech perception is purely auditory. Ito’s research has since shown that the brain integrates tactile cues from the vocal tract with auditory input to refine both speech production and perceptual processing, with key contributions including the discovery that speech sounds can alter facial skin sensation and that somatosensory feedback is critical for quick speech motor corrections even without hearing. His work has profound implications for understanding speech development, motor learning, and rehabilitation. With over 340 total citations, Ito has also explored applications in robotics, such as developing a sense of self-location for extra robotic thumbs. His innovative use of robotic devices to deliver precise orofacial skin stretch stimulation has opened new avenues for studying somatosensory event-related potentials, cementing his reputation as a leader in multisensory speech research.
